Problems solved by technology

Since crawling exercises are very easily limited by the conditions of the location and the weather, it is hence necessary to develop an exerciser which can simulate crawling movements and overcome the limits of the location and the weather.
Although the crawling exerciser in the state of the art can theoretically have the workout effect by crawling movement, it has the following flaws practically: First, it is hard to stop the movements.

example 1

[0060]A crawling exerciser, as shown in FIGS. 6 and 7, comprises two hand slides 101 each containing a wheel and two leg slides 102 each containing a wheel 103. It contains a soft rollable carpet track 100, the material of which can be plastics, etc. When the carpet is unfolded, the track is parallel and the cross section of the track is groove-shaped, which corresponds with the shape of the wheel 103. Both the hand slides 101 and the leg slides 102 slide in the track and make linear movements so that the wheels will not move astray. In addition, the friction between the wheel and the groove of the track is used to provide damping in order to control the hand wheels 101 and the leg wheels 102. It is very easy to perform hand and leg alternate movements with this exerciser.

example 2

[0061]A crawling exerciser, as shown in FIGS. 8 and 9, comprises two hand slides 201 each containing a wheel and two leg slides 202 each containing a wheel 203. It contains a soft rollable carpet track 200, the material of which can be plastics, etc. When the carpet is unfolded, the track is parallel and is a straight, long fin height structure. The outer part of the wheel 203 is furnished with a curved groove in order to adapt to the fin-height-shaped track. When it is used, the outer part of the wheel of the hand slide 201 and the leg slide 202 is furnished with a groove in order to adapt to the fin-height-shaped track. The slides can make linear movements so that the wheels will not move astray. In addition, the friction between the wheel and the groove of the track is used to provide damping in order to control the hand wheels 201 and the leg wheels 202. It is very easy to perform hand and leg alternate movements with this exerciser.

example 3

[0062]A crawling exerciser, as shown in FIG. 10, comprises two hand slides 301 each containing a wheel and two leg slides 302 each containing a wheel. It contains parallel track components 300. The hard track components 300 can be made of non-metallic material (such as plastics) or metals (aluminum or iron or etc); The shape of the track can be groove-shaped, fin height shaped, or trapezoidal, etc. It can also be two parallel round tubes. The hand slides 301 and the leg slides 302 can make linear movements so that the wheels will not move astray. In order to increase the damping of the hand slide 301 and leg slide 302 to increase their controllability, an elastic string 303 (or more than one string) is provided between the hand slide 301 and the leg slide 302 on the same side in this example. In this way, it is easier to perform alternate movements with the hands and the legs.

Abstract

The current invention relates to an exerciser, especially a crawling exerciser, comprising two hand slides each containing a wheel and two leg slides each containing a wheel, characterized in that, characterized in that it also contains components of a linear parallel track, wherein both the hand slides and the leg slides slide in the track and a damping structure is installed on the wheels or between the wheels and the track. The exerciser of the current invention is convenient, flexible, easy to control, and is easy to perform alternate movements of the hands and legs. It does not damage the floor, carpet or ground, and is very appropriate for indoor application.

Crawling exercises belong to horizontal movement (which mainly means that the human spine is horizontal to the ground during the movement). In comparison with the vertical position movements, the human spine is being protected due to low pressure, because the gravity can be reduced or completely eliminated during the horizontal movement.
